US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"in a practical world"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it to refer to a realistic or pragmatic context or situation in discussions or arguments. Example: "In a practical world, we must consider the limitations of our resources when planning our projects."

Expert writing Tips

Best practice

When using "in a practical world", ensure you're contrasting it with a theoretical or ideal situation to highlight the need for realistic solutions.

Common error

Avoid using "in a practical world" when the context already implies reality. It can become redundant if not contrasted with theoretical possibilities.

Linguistic Context

The phrase "in a practical world" functions as an adverbial prepositional phrase, modifying a clause by specifying the context or conditions under which an action or situation is considered. It introduces a realistic viewpoint, as shown in Ludwig's examples.

FAQs

How can I use "in a practical world" in a sentence?

Use "in a practical world" to introduce considerations that are grounded in reality, especially when contrasting them with ideals. For example: "In a practical world, we must consider budget constraints."

Is it correct to say "in practical world"?

While understandable, the standard phrasing is "in a practical world". The inclusion of the article "a" makes the phrase grammatically correct and more natural-sounding.

What is the difference between "in a practical world" and "in theory"?

"In a practical world" highlights real-world considerations and limitations. "In theory" describes what should happen ideally, often without accounting for real-world constraints. They are often used in contrast to each other.
